Transaction 29995757779b219fd01d3a38c22391e40425afb16fd2931b993a505367e76b05

29 Input
2 Outputs
  • 29995757779b219fd01d3a38c22391e40425afb16fd2931b993a505367e76b05:0
  • value  67141
    address  1MkswCj1Nv8P5wLHu8AQwxqdr7p7zzPXzH
  • 29995757779b219fd01d3a38c22391e40425afb16fd2931b993a505367e76b05:1
  • value  4000000
    address  3NodRagHWaaquJgFnES2oUn7JkXDdS3QBA